So, I know a hot topic has been how to display catcher's gear. This is what I came up with since I don't have room to use an entire mannequin or something similar. What I did was mount wooden dowels to the wall for each piece of equipment. I still plan to paint the dowels red to match the wall. Let me know your thoughts and/or suggestions. Thanks!
